How it feels

In 1940s France, a woman from a poor background starts performing abortions to earn extra money. The film shows her domestic struggles and the escalating legal jeopardy she faces.

What happens

Story of Women (French: Une affaire de femmes) is a 1988 French drama film directed by Claude Chabrol, based on the true story of Marie-Louise Giraud, guillotined on 30 July 1943 for having performed 27 abortions in the Cherbourg area, and the 1986 book Une affaire de femmes by Francis Szpiner. The film premiered at the 45th Venice International Film Festival, in which Isabelle Huppert was awarded the prize for Best Actress. It has been cited as a favorite by filmmaker John Waters, who presented it as his annual selection within the 2008 Maryland Film Festival.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
